小编Ros*_*tev的帖子

如何在dplyr中提取一个特定的组

给定一个分组的tbl,我可以提取一个/几个组吗?在对代码进行原型设计时,此类功能非常有用,例如:

mtcars %>%
  group_by(cyl) %>%
  select_first_n_groups(2) %>%
  do({'complicated expression'})
Run Code Online (Sandbox Code Playgroud)

当然,可以在分组之前进行显式过滤,但这可能很麻烦.

group-by r dplyr

7
推荐指数
2
解决办法
2436
查看次数

在R中显示热图上的值

我正在使用heatmap.2制作热图,并想知道是否还有在所有热图位置上显示值.例如,对于表示"1"和等级的区域,我想显示值"43",表示"2",并将值51赋予特权等等.

我的样本数据如下: 在此输入图像描述

            rating complaints privileges learning raises critical advance
      1      43         51         30       39     61       92      45
      2      63         64         51       54     63       73      47
      3      71         70         68       69     76       86      48
      4      61         63         45       47     54       84      35
Run Code Online (Sandbox Code Playgroud)

r heatmap

5
推荐指数
1
解决办法
8340
查看次数

标签 统计

r ×2

dplyr ×1

group-by ×1

heatmap ×1